Born in 1958 as (Virginia Brown) in a coastal town, known as Belfast. The
state of Maine, is where she was raised and grew up as the third child of
Clarence and Sheila (Roberts) Brown. As a child, she would sit on the
veranda with pen and pad in hand writing for hours upon hours. She had a
diary her mother gave her to write in, with a little lock and key; that
diary soon turned into tablets of writings, then into notebooks of writings,
and when asked, she confessed: "Into now-- a suitcase of writings."
Virginia
always dreamed of being a published poet, or a storybook writer, and that one day her
stories and
books
would be read and enjoyed by many... Wright said, "What a rewarding feeling
it is, to know that something you wrote mattered in someone's life; that it
may have made someone stop and think for a moment, smile, or even
laugh." Virginia Wright is now living in the Downeast area in the beautiful state of
Maine.
More about the Author:
VIRGINIA WRIGHT is author and illustrator of the children's
books-- Crying Bear, The Princess and the Castle, The Prince and
the Dragon, and Buzzzzzzzz. Virginia
says she has found her love of words in children's writing.
Wright says being a preschool teacher for a number of years at a
private Christian Preschool and Kindergarten in Mississippi was
definitely an inspiration for writing children's books, but the
true inspiration comes from her five grandchildren and her
special needs brother-in-law that she cares for and who lives with
she and her husband.

VIRGINIA WRIGHT a published author...
After graduating high school class of 1976, she took coursework in
Journalism and Writing. Later while raising children, her writings were published in an Anthology-- Soundings, by
The Poetry Fellowship of Maine; a derivative writing was also published in
newsprint by the Bangor Daily Newspaper. But she first considers herself a published
author when she sold one of her writings to a regional Maine magazine in 1981. She says her dream was realized that day
looking at her work in print and holding the check in her hand, but her
dreams just deepened...

From the Author...
For over 30+ years I have been married to a man who made the military his
career. With living and traveling in Europe there was always an
adventure around every corner- starting with racing around Rome on Vespa's
and attending service at the Vatican and being blessed by the Pope,
to traveling by train to Venice. Then there was the ride up Mt. Etna in Sicily on the ski
gondola, to giving birth abroad in Naples, Italy; and I will never
forget the day I participated in a bullfight in Spain by distracting the
bull, I had to shimmy up a pole and ring a bell in an attempt to win a
bottle of champagne; oh, my! I can
tell you for certain-- there has never been any room for boredom in my life,
and by the way, I won that bottle of champagne... It was
hard to call any place home while being a military wife, besides living in
Europe, home was also seven different states for myself and family.
My husband and I have two grown sons, Rob and Shane-- a daughter-in-law and
five grandchildren. I presently live in Ohio
with my husband where I write in the hills high above the valley. We
live on our twenty acre farm and when I'm not watering our multiple gardens, canning,
collecting sap, cooking, feeding our chickens and dog, my time is spent as a freelance
writer, but these days instead of a pen and pad still in hand, it is
the computer keyboard and a click of the mouse, but I am still doing what I enjoy doing most,
Writing...
